当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器自己搭建数据库怎么弄,云服务器自建数据库全攻略,从零开始搭建高效稳定的数据仓库

云服务器自己搭建数据库怎么弄,云服务器自建数据库全攻略,从零开始搭建高效稳定的数据仓库

云服务器自建数据库攻略,助您从零开始搭建高效稳定的数据仓库。本文详细介绍了搭建过程,涵盖数据库选择、配置优化、安全性保障等关键环节,让您的数据存储无忧。...

云服务器自建数据库攻略,助您从零开始搭建高效稳定的数据仓库。本文详细介绍了搭建过程,涵盖数据库选择、配置优化、安全性保障等关键环节,让您的数据存储无忧。

随着互联网技术的飞速发展,企业对数据库的需求越来越大,云服务器凭借其便捷、高效、弹性伸缩等特点,成为了搭建数据库的理想选择,本文将详细讲解如何在云服务器上自建数据库,从基础环境搭建到性能优化,全面解析数据库自建的整个过程。

云服务器选择

1、云服务器品牌:市面上主流的云服务器品牌有阿里云、腾讯云、华为云等,选择云服务器时,可以根据企业需求和预算进行选择。

2、配置选择:数据库对服务器性能要求较高,建议选择以下配置:

- CPU:至少2核

- 内存:至少4GB

云服务器自己搭建数据库怎么弄,云服务器自建数据库全攻略,从零开始搭建高效稳定的数据仓库

- 硬盘:SSD硬盘,至少100GB

3、地域选择:根据企业业务需求和数据传输速度,选择合适的地域。

数据库软件选择

1、关系型数据库:MySQL、Oracle、SQL Server等

2、非关系型数据库:MongoDB、Redis、Cassandra等

根据业务需求选择合适的数据库软件,以下以MySQL为例进行讲解。

数据库安装与配置

1、登录云服务器

使用SSH客户端(如PuTTY)连接到云服务器,默认用户名为root,密码为登录云服务器时设置的密码。

2、安装MySQL

云服务器自己搭建数据库怎么弄,云服务器自建数据库全攻略,从零开始搭建高效稳定的数据仓库

(1)下载MySQL安装包:进入MySQL官网,下载适合Linux操作系统的MySQL安装包。

(2)安装MySQL:使用以下命令安装MySQL。

sudo apt-get update
sudo apt-get install mysql-server

3、配置MySQL

(1)设置root用户密码:使用以下命令设置root用户密码。

sudo mysql_secure_installation

(2)配置MySQL远程访问:编辑MySQL配置文件/etc/mysql/my.cnf,添加以下内容。

[mysqld]
bind-address = 0.0.0.0

重启MySQL服务,使配置生效。

4、登录MySQL

使用以下命令登录MySQL。

云服务器自己搭建数据库怎么弄,云服务器自建数据库全攻略,从零开始搭建高效稳定的数据仓库

mysql -u root -p

输入密码后,即可进入MySQL命令行界面。

数据库优化

1、优化MySQL配置文件:根据业务需求和服务器性能,调整MySQL配置文件/etc/mysql/my.cnf中的相关参数,如innodb_buffer_pool_sizeinnodb_log_file_size等。

2、优化SQL语句:优化SQL语句可以提高数据库查询效率,以下是一些常见的SQL优化技巧:

- 使用索引:合理使用索引可以加快查询速度。

- 避免全表扫描:尽量使用索引进行查询,避免全表扫描。

- 避免SELECT *:只查询需要的字段,避免查询过多数据。

3、定期备份:定期备份数据库,以防数据丢失。

黑狐家游戏

发表评论

最新文章